When I began my studies for design, through the University of Tennessee for Architecture and Design, I found myself being pulled toward the most to the concept of functionality and mentality — incorporating nurturing aspects for both mental and physical health as well as storage and accessibility so that the spaces actually work well.

In order to truly thrive, our home environments should function as a sanctuary. We can choose to use our spaces for recovery, purpose and prayer, hosting and connection, or simply rest. the spaces we live and work in aren't just a backdrop to life. They are foundations for it.

In fact, studies over the past decade have consistently shown that a well-designed, orderly, and nurturing environment leads to higher levels of happiness, productivity, and overall wellness. One study published in the Journal of Environmental Psychology concluded that physical clutter and disorganized spaces are directly linked to increased levels of cortisol (our stress hormone). Another study conducted by Roger Ulrich in the 1980’s in short, found that when people live surrounded by beauty, greenery, and open light, they their quality of life dramatically improves, reinforcing the idea that our environment is more impactful than we realize. Since then, countless hospitals, nursing homes, and eldercare facilities have designed patient rooms, with large windows that overlook greenery and gardens and maximized natural light through views of the outdoors. Follow-up research has shown that the residents of these facilities experienced:

  • Lower rates of depression

  • Higher reported happiness

  • Improved mobility and cognitive function

  • Longer life expectancy compared to those in sterile, enclosed environments
